Transaction faee32d046ebe293f55a9ef31c0c108f7a229e0875be50b450c025396ceff870
1 Input
2 Outputs
- faee32d046ebe293f55a9ef31c0c108f7a229e0875be50b450c025396ceff870:0
- faee32d046ebe293f55a9ef31c0c108f7a229e0875be50b450c025396ceff870:1
value 2886431
address 14wthCDVmb1K2Y8TcT5fA5o62HFSxdW2EK
value 111899597
address 1D6VjnChhTk3QzLs1KoBj3P8RepRuLVYaA